Alternatively, you can make a separate S3 class for a data frame with this attribute -- and then have appropriate, print, plot, etc. methods that access it. That way, your messy syntax has to be written only once in the method functions.
-- Bert On Mon, Oct 3, 2011 at 8:15 AM, Joshua Wiley <jwiley.ps...@gmail.com> wrote: > Hi Bruno, > > It sounds like what you want is really a separate class, one that has > stores information about units for each variable. This is far from an > elegant example, but depending on your situation may be useful. I > create a new class inheriting from the data frame class. This is > likely fraught with problems because a formal S4 class is inheriting > from an informal S3. Then a data frame can be stored in the .Data > slot (special---I did not make it), but character data can also be > stored in the units slot (which I did define). You could get fancier > imposing constraints that the length of units be equal to the number > of columns in the data frame or the like. S3 methods for data frames > should still mostly work, but you also have the ability to access the > new units slot. You could define special S4 methods to do the > extraction then, if you wanted, so that your ultimate syntax to get > the units of a particular variable would be shorter. > > setOldClass("data.frame") > > setClass("mydf", representation(units = "character"), > contains = "data.frame", S3methods = TRUE) > > tmp <- new("mydf") > > tmp@.Data <- mtcars > tmp@row.names <- rownames(mtcars) > tmp@units <- c("x", "y") > > ## data frameish > colMeans(tmp) > tmp + 10 > > # but > tmp@units > > Cheers, > > Josh > > N.B.
